Thinking about buying a Big agnes tent. Lynx pass 4 is the model Im looking at. It will be a camping tent, not for hiking. Needs to fit 3 adults. 3 season tent. Must be very good at standing up to storms!!! I always get rained on at least once. Any thoughts, ideas?
 
not bad tents. look for the reviews. with large bulky tents like that keep it for car camping only. if you had to haul that beast around you will only do it once. they seem to be well built.. now if you are talking high wind storms, remember, if you know where the storms and wind direction place your tent where the broad side is not facing the full force of the wind. thats a basic rule for all tents.
